#4d60b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d60b4 is composed of 30.2% red, 37.6%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.2% cyan, 46.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 228.9 degrees, a saturation of 40.7% and a lightness of 50.4%. #4d60b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#9ac0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#4d60b4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3f4f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d60b4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7f83 is the less saturated color, while #0935f8 is the most saturated one.
